German term (edited): jmd. zeigen, was eine Harke ist

put the others in their place

to be coolest of them all, that kind of thing is meant when somebody "zeigt jemand, was eine Harke ist".

showing a person what's what

To put a person in one's place is more of a rebuke, while I understand this context to be more about showing off.

German term (edited): jemandem zeigen, was eine Harke ist

to give someone a good thrashing / good dressing down

to make somebody look bad by showing them impressively how it's done/ by demonstrating one's superiority

basically to beat them at anything they are doing
to give them a good/sound thrashing

give someone a good dressing down - this is often used as English equivalent:
